LAFOLLETTE, TN (WLAF) – For many who may not know, this was the view on the four lane on Highway 25W and Towe String Road.  

The house behind the Key Limestone billboard is now where Walgreens is. This roadway was built to replace the old road, the two lane road that runs in front of Lyk-Nu Auto Collision and Service Center, and you travel under the railroad underpass, the Skyway Bridge.

The four lane road was completed in the 1950s. There were very few businesses on this stretch of roadway until the 1970s. Some of the early businesses were Lay’s Bar, Leon’s Esso, later Leon’s Exxon, La Follette Monument, Sharp’s Phillips 66, The Colonial Restaurant and motel along with the Birdwell Motel and Sharp’s Motel.
